Police have arrested two men and seized methamphetamine and cash during search warrants at addresses in Christchurch and Dunedin this week.
It comes after a five-week investigation culminated with three addresses being searched on Monday, police said.
Over half a kilogram of methamphetamine was seized, worth $192,000, as well as $67,000 in cash from the properties.
A 38-year-old was remanded in custody and was due to appear in Christchurch District Court on 17 September.
He was charged with possession and supplying methamphetamine.
A 68-year-old is also due to appear in Dunedin District Court on 9 September, charged with possession of methamphetamine for supply.
